Latest Patents

Kenneth holds a patent for a "Polymer with pendent cyclic olefinic functions for oxygen scavenging packaging." This innovative family of polymers contains selected cyclic allylic pendent groups that effectively scavenge oxygen while producing minimal organoleptic by-products after oxidation.
